Who was Franklin Lafayette Riley, Jr.?

Franklin Lafayette Riley Jr. was an American historian. In his capacity as a professor at the University of Mississippi at Oxford, he helped to establish the Mississippi Department of Archives and History. In 1902, he wrote a paper detailing the lineage of his grandfather, Edward Riley, and his descendants.
